"There’s no good advice on this album": Tove Lo announces new record Estrus

14 May 2026, 07:30 | Written by Best Fit

Tove Lo has revealed her sixth studio album Estrus will drop this September and released the lead single “I’m your girl right?”

“Estrus is an animal in heat," explains Lo. "It’s primal. It’s my mind and my body wanting different things, wanting everything. There’s no good advice on this album… just a lot of feelings, no solutions.”

The 13-track LP was recorded in Los Angeles, Stockholm, and a small fishing village in Sweden where the Swedish singer spent summers as a child. It features a collaboration with Belgian artist Stromae and was produced by longtime collaborator Ludvig Söderberg alongside Elvira Anderfjärd and Luka Kloser, who has worked with Addison Rae.

The video for “I’m your girl right?” was shot outside São Paulo in a former monastery and features over 70 dancers. It marks the second time Tove Lo has worked with director Nogari, following 2023’s “Borderline”.

Lo has also announced European dates to support the record, which kick off in Manchester on 5 November and include a London show at Brixton Academy. Fans can sign up for presale at tove-lo.com.

Estrus tracklist

“a lot of feelings, no solutions”
“I’m your girl right?”
“if I could I would”
“des fleurs x stromae”
“DNH”
“F.A.M.T”
“I’m the cake”
“the bad one”
“die for my art with a lonely heart”
“are we on a break”
“idiot”
“roomie”
“source of life”

Estrus is released on 18 September via Pretty Swede Records
